Woman admits to stabbing 85-year-old man inside Terrytown home, JP sheriff says

Deputies called to home after victim's son could not get in touch with him in recent days

TERRYTOWN -- Deputies called to check on an 85-year-old man whose relatives had not heard from him in recent days were greeted at the door of his home by a woman who admitted she stabbed him to death, Jefferson Parish Sheriff Joe Lopinto said.

Deputies found the man’s lifeless body inside his house about 12:30 p.m. Tuesday at the house in the 600 block of National Avenue, Lopinto said.

He declined to identify the victim until authorities could notify his family. The woman was later identified as 46-year-old Krystal Behrens. She was a roommate of the man, according to the sheriff's office.

Behrens will be booked on a count of second-degree murder. He said the woman was being treated for “psychiatric conditions.”

Lopinto said deputies arrived at the home after the victim’s son said he had not heard from his father in recent days.

While the coroner will have to determine how long the victim had been dead before he was found, Lopinto said it appears to have been days. “At least a week or so,” he said.

He added that it appears the victim was stabbed one time.

Lopinto declined to say if the suspect said why she stabbed the victim but that it appeared she stayed with him inside the home since he died.

“This is not common,” Lopinto said. “It’s not a random act that we’re looking for someone that came into someone’s home.”
